Home
last modified time | relevance | path

Searched refs:HidlUtils (Results 1 – 18 of 18) sorted by relevance

/aosp12/hardware/interfaces/audio/common/all-versions/default/tests/
H A Dhidlutils_tests.cpp84 TEST(HidlUtils, ConvertChannelMask) { in TEST() argument
200 TEST(HidlUtils, ConvertConfigBase) { in TEST() argument
411 TEST(HidlUtils, ConvertDeviceType) { in TEST() argument
437 TEST(HidlUtils, VendorExtension) { in TEST() argument
571 TEST(HidlUtils, ConvertFormat) { in TEST() argument
658 TEST(HidlUtils, ConvertSource) { in TEST() argument
715 TEST(HidlUtils, ConvertGain) { in TEST() argument
762 TEST(HidlUtils, ConvertUsage) { in TEST() argument
854 TEST(HidlUtils, ConvertConfig) { in TEST() argument
1085 HidlUtils::audioTagsFromHal(HidlUtils::splitAudioTags(halOneTag), &oneTagBack)); in TEST()
[all …]
H A Dhidlutils6_tests.cpp27 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
57 EXPECT_EQ(NO_ERROR, HidlUtils::deviceAddressToHal(device, &halDeviceType, halDeviceAddress)); in ConvertDeviceAddress()
60 HidlUtils::deviceAddressFromHal(halDeviceType, halDeviceAddress, &deviceBack)); in ConvertDeviceAddress()
/aosp12/hardware/interfaces/audio/core/all-versions/default/util/
H A DCoreUtils.cpp25 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
46 return HidlUtils::deviceAddressToHal(device, halDeviceType, halDeviceAddress); in deviceAddressToHal()
48 return HidlUtils::deviceAddressToHalImpl(device, halDeviceType, halDeviceAddress); in deviceAddressToHal()
55 return HidlUtils::deviceAddressFromHal(halDeviceType, halDeviceAddress, device); in deviceAddressFromHal()
57 return HidlUtils::deviceAddressFromHalImpl(halDeviceType, halDeviceAddress, device); in deviceAddressFromHal()
207 strTags = HidlUtils::filterOutNonVendorTags(strTags); in sinkMetadataFromHalV7()
257 CONVERT_CHECKED(HidlUtils::audioChannelMaskToHal(trackMetadata.channelMask, in sinkMetadataToHalV7()
262 HidlUtils::audioTagsToHal(HidlUtils::filterOutNonVendorTags(trackMetadata.tags), in sinkMetadataToHalV7()
322 strTags = HidlUtils::filterOutNonVendorTags(strTags); in sourceMetadataFromHalV7()
342 CONVERT_CHECKED(HidlUtils::audioContentTypeToHal(trackMetadata.contentType, in sourceMetadataToHal()
[all …]
/aosp12/hardware/interfaces/audio/common/all-versions/default/7.0/
H A DHidlUtils.cpp119 status_t HidlUtils::audioChannelMaskToHal(const AudioChannelMask& channelMask, in audioChannelMaskToHal()
141 status_t HidlUtils::audioConfigBaseToHal(const AudioConfigBase& configBase, in audioConfigBaseToHal()
339 status_t HidlUtils::audioStreamTypeFromHal(audio_stream_type_t halStreamType, in audioStreamTypeFromHal()
354 status_t HidlUtils::audioStreamTypeToHal(const AudioStreamType& streamType, in audioStreamTypeToHal()
423 status_t HidlUtils::audioGainConfigToHal(const AudioGainConfig& config, in audioGainConfigToHal()
538 status_t HidlUtils::audioOffloadInfoToHal(const AudioOffloadInfo& offload, in audioOffloadInfoToHal()
594 status_t HidlUtils::audioPortConfigToHal(const AudioPortConfig& config, in audioPortConfigToHal()
629 status_t HidlUtils::audioPortExtendedInfoFromHal( in audioPortExtendedInfoFromHal()
957 status_t HidlUtils::audioProfileToHal(const AudioProfile& profile, in audioProfileToHal()
1051 std::vector<std::string> HidlUtils::splitAudioTags(const char* halTags) { in splitAudioTags()
[all …]
/aosp12/hardware/interfaces/audio/common/all-versions/default/
H A DHidlUtils.cpp40 status_t HidlUtils::audioConfigToHal(const AudioConfig& config, audio_config_t* halConfig) { in audioConfigToHal()
50 status_t HidlUtils::audioGainConfigFromHal(const struct audio_gain_config& halConfig, bool, in audioGainConfigFromHal()
62 status_t HidlUtils::audioGainConfigToHal(const AudioGainConfig& config, in audioGainConfigToHal()
87 status_t HidlUtils::audioGainToHal(const AudioGain& gain, struct audio_gain* halGain) { in audioGainToHal()
99 status_t HidlUtils::audioUsageFromHal(audio_usage_t halUsage, AudioUsage* usage) { in audioUsageFromHal()
113 status_t HidlUtils::audioUsageToHal(const AudioUsage& usage, audio_usage_t* halUsage) { in audioUsageToHal()
118 status_t HidlUtils::audioOffloadInfoFromHal(const audio_offload_info_t& halOffload, in audioOffloadInfoFromHal()
153 status_t HidlUtils::audioOffloadInfoToHal(const AudioOffloadInfo& offload, in audioOffloadInfoToHal()
178 status_t HidlUtils::audioPortConfigFromHal(const struct audio_port_config& halConfig, in audioPortConfigFromHal()
216 status_t HidlUtils::audioPortConfigToHal(const AudioPortConfig& config, in audioPortConfigToHal()
[all …]
H A DHidlUtils.h38 struct HidlUtils { struct
176 inline status_t HidlUtils::audioContentTypeFromHal(const audio_content_type_t halContentType, in audioContentTypeFromHal()
182 inline status_t HidlUtils::audioContentTypeToHal(const AudioContentType& contentType, in audioContentTypeToHal()
189 inline status_t HidlUtils::audioSourceFromHal(audio_source_t halSource, AudioSource* source) { in audioSourceFromHal()
194 inline status_t HidlUtils::audioSourceToHal(const AudioSource& source, audio_source_t* halSource) { in audioSourceToHal()
200 status_t HidlUtils::deviceAddressToHalImpl(const DA& device, audio_devices_t* halDeviceType, in deviceAddressToHalImpl()
229 status_t HidlUtils::deviceAddressFromHalImpl(audio_devices_t halDeviceType, in deviceAddressFromHalImpl()
H A DHidlUtilsCommon.cpp26 status_t HidlUtils::audioPortConfigsFromHal(unsigned int numHalConfigs, in audioPortConfigsFromHal()
40 status_t HidlUtils::audioPortConfigsToHal(const hidl_vec<AudioPortConfig>& configs, in audioPortConfigsToHal()
H A DAndroid.bp54 "HidlUtils.cpp",
144 "7.0/HidlUtils.cpp",
/aosp12/frameworks/av/media/libaudiohal/impl/
H A DDeviceHalHidl.cpp37 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
176 HidlUtils::audioConfigFromHal(*config, true /*isInput*/, &hidlConfig); in getInputBufferSize()
222 HidlUtils::audioConfigToHal(suggestedConfig, config); in openOutputStream()
263 if (status_t status = HidlUtils::audioSourceFromHal(source, &hidlSource); status != OK) { in openInputStream()
273 (void)HidlUtils::audioChannelMaskFromHal( in openInputStream()
292 HidlUtils::audioConfigToHal(suggestedConfig, config); in openInputStream()
321 HidlUtils::audioPortConfigsFromHal(num_sources, sources, &hidlSources); in createAudioPatch()
322 HidlUtils::audioPortConfigsFromHal(num_sinks, sinks, &hidlSinks); in createAudioPatch()
361 HidlUtils::audioPortFromHal(*port, &hidlPort); in getAudioPortImpl()
368 HidlUtils::audioPortToHal(p, port); in getAudioPortImpl()
[all …]
H A DStreamHalHidl.cpp35 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
98 conversionStatus = HidlUtils::audioConfigBaseToHal(config, configBase); in getAudioProperties()
/aosp12/hardware/interfaces/audio/core/all-versions/default/
H A DDevice.cpp44 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
142 if (HidlUtils::audioConfigToHal(config, &halConfig) == NO_ERROR) { in getInputBufferSize()
159 if (HidlUtils::audioConfigToHal(config, &halConfig) != NO_ERROR) { in openOutputStreamImpl()
185 HidlUtils::audioConfigFromHal(halConfig, false /*isInput*/, suggestedConfig); in openOutputStreamImpl()
194 if (HidlUtils::audioConfigToHal(config, &halConfig) != NO_ERROR) { in openInputStreamImpl()
206 HidlUtils::audioSourceToHal(source, &halSource) != NO_ERROR) { in openInputStreamImpl()
222 HidlUtils::audioConfigFromHal(halConfig, true /*isInput*/, suggestedConfig); in openInputStreamImpl()
337 if (status_t status = HidlUtils::audioPortConfigsToHal(sources, &halSources); in openOutputStream()
342 if (status_t status = HidlUtils::audioPortConfigsToHal(sinks, &halSinks); in openOutputStream()
377 if (status_t status = HidlUtils::audioPortFromHal(halPort, &resultPort); in openOutputStream()
[all …]
H A DStream.cpp40 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
227 (void)HidlUtils::audioFormatsFromHal(halFormats, &formats); in getSupportedProfiles()
231 if (status_t status = HidlUtils::audioFormatToHal(format, &halFormat); status != NO_ERROR) { in getSupportedProfiles()
252 (void)HidlUtils::audioChannelMasksFromHal(halChannelMasks, &channelMasks); in getSupportedProfiles()
276 status_t status = HidlUtils::audioConfigBaseFromHal(halConfigBase, mIsInput, &configBase); in getAudioProperties()
284 status_t status = HidlUtils::audioConfigBaseOptionalToHal( in setAudioProperties()
H A DStreamIn.cpp40 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
344 HidlUtils::audioSourceFromHal(static_cast<audio_source_t>(halSource), &source)); in getAudioSource()
H A DStreamOut.cpp42 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
/aosp12/hardware/interfaces/audio/effect/all-versions/default/
H A DVirtualizerEffect.cpp37 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
211 if (status_t status = HidlUtils::audioChannelMaskToHal(mask, &halChannelMask); in getVirtualSpeakerAngles()
220 if (status_t status = HidlUtils::deviceAddressToHal(device, &halDeviceType, halDeviceAddress); in getVirtualSpeakerAngles()
257 (void)HidlUtils::deviceAddressFromHal(static_cast<audio_devices_t>(halMode), nullptr, &device); in getVirtualSpeakerAngles()
271 (void)HidlUtils::deviceAddressToHal(device, &halDeviceType, halDeviceAddress); in getVirtualSpeakerAngles()
309 return HidlUtils::audioChannelMaskFromHal(halMask, false /*isInput*/, &speakerAngles.mask); in getVirtualSpeakerAngles()
H A DEffect.cpp47 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
209 (void)HidlUtils::audioChannelMaskFromHal(halConfig.main_channels, mIsInput, in effectAuxChannelsConfigFromHal()
211 (void)HidlUtils::audioChannelMaskFromHal(halConfig.aux_channels, mIsInput, in effectAuxChannelsConfigFromHal()
218 (void)HidlUtils::audioChannelMaskToHal(config.mainChannels, &halConfig->main_channels); in effectAuxChannelsConfigToHal()
219 (void)HidlUtils::audioChannelMaskToHal(config.auxChannels, &halConfig->aux_channels); in effectAuxChannelsConfigToHal()
504 if (status_t status = HidlUtils::audioSourceToHal(source, &halSource); status == NO_ERROR) { in setAudioSource()
531 if (status_t status = HidlUtils::deviceAddressToHal(device, &halDevice, halDeviceAddress); in setDevice()
543 if (status_t status = HidlUtils::deviceAddressToHal(device, &halDevice, halDeviceAddress); in setInputDevice()
/aosp12/hardware/interfaces/audio/core/all-versions/vts/functional/7.0/
H A DPolicyConfig.cpp35 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
140 if (HidlUtils::audioDeviceTypeToHal(devicePort->getType(), &halDeviceType) == in getDeviceAddressOfDevicePort()
146 if (HidlUtils::deviceAddressFromHal(halDeviceType, address.c_str(), &result) == in getDeviceAddressOfDevicePort()
/aosp12/hardware/interfaces/audio/effect/all-versions/default/util/
H A DEffectUtils.cpp28 using ::android::hardware::audio::common::CPP_VERSION::implementation::HidlUtils;
87 CONVERT_CHECKED(HidlUtils::audioConfigBaseOptionalFromHal( in effectBufferConfigFromHal()
108 HidlUtils::audioConfigBaseOptionalToHal(config.base, &halConfigBase, &formatSpecified, in effectBufferConfigToHal()